Data Architect?
DAMA International's Data Management Body of Knowledge

Data Architect?

Data architects are senior visionaries who translate business requirements into technical requirements and define data standards and principles. The data architect is responsible for visualizing and designing an organization's enterprise data management framework. This framework describes the processes used to plan, specify, enable, create, acquire, maintain, use, archive, retrieve, control, and purge data. The data architect also "provides a standard common business vocabulary, expresses strategic requirements, outlines high-level integrated designs to meet those requirements, and aligns with enterprise strategy and related business architecture," 

No alt text provided for this image
Data Architects are often involved in creating and executing an organization’s overall data strategy and setting enterprise-wide quality metrics. Here are several ways to measure and evaluate the success of a data solution.

Data architect responsibilities

  • Translating business requirements into technical specifications, including data streams, integrations, transformations, databases, and data warehouses
  • Defining the data architecture framework, standards, and principles, including modeling, metadata, security, reference data such as product codes and client categories, and master data such as clients, vendors, materials, and employees
  • Defining reference architecture, which is a pattern that others can follow to create and improve data systems
  • Defining data flows, i.e., which parts of the organization generate data, which require data to function, how data flows are managed, and how data changes in the transition
  • Collaborating and coordinating with multiple departments, stakeholders, partners, and external vendors

Data architect skills

According to Bob Lambert, analytics delivery lead at Anthem and former director of CapTech Consulting, important data architect skills include:

  • A foundation in systems development. Data architects must understand the system development life cycle, project management approaches, and requirements, design, and test techniques, Lambert says.
  • Data modeling and design. This is the core skill of the data architect and the most requested skill in data architect job descriptions, according to Lambert, who notes that this often includes SQL development and database administration.
  • Established and emerging data technologies. Data architects need to understand established data management and reporting technologies and have some knowledge of columnar and NoSQL databases, predictive analytics, data visualization, and unstructured data.
  • Communication and political savvy. Data architects need people skills. They must be articulate, persuasive, and good salespeople, Lambert says, and they must conceive and portray the big data picture to others.

Data architect salary

According to data from Robert Half's 2020 Technology and IT Salary Guide, the average salary for data architects in the US, based on experience, breaks down as follows:

5th percentile: $119,750
50th percentile: $141,250
75th percentile: $163,500
95th percentile: $193,500

Data architect jobs

A recent search for data architect jobs on Indeed.com showed positions available in a range of industries, including financial services, consulting, healthcare, pharmaceuticals, technology, and higher education.

A sampling of data architect job descriptions shows key areas of responsibility such as: creating a data ops and BI transformation roadmap, developing and sustaining a data strategy, implementing and optimizing physical database design, and designing and implementing data migration and integration processes.

Work closely with teams to collect and translate information requirements into data to develop data-centric solutions


Ensure that industry-accepted data architecture principles and standards are integrated and followed for modeling, stored procedures, replication, regulations, and security, among other concepts, to meet technical and business goals


Continuously improve the quality, consistency, accessibility, and security of our data activity across the company needs





要查看或添加评论,请登录

社区洞察

其他会员也浏览了